Seriously fine thread: “60” refers to an ultra-fine yarn count (the kind used in dress shirts), which gives the S60 its distinctive smoothness — crafted with precise technology and long-held expertise.
Meticulously yarn-dyed: Each thread is dyed before weaving rather than dyeing the finished towel, helping preserve the natural hand-feel and producing more nuanced colour.
Triple-threaded weave: Three complementary, pre-dyed threads are spun into a single yarn, creating depth and a subtle, sophisticated finish.
